Modern day versions of tughras

History
1 answer:
kari74 [83]3 years ago
6 0

Answer: A tughra (Ottoman Turkish: طغرا‎, romanized: tuğrâ) is a calligraphic monogram, seal or signature of a sultan that was affixed to all official documents and correspondence. Inspired by the tamgha, it was also carved on his seal and stamped on the coins minted during his reign.

What were the causes, events, and consequences of the Korean War?
ratelena [41]
Different political ideologies, The Cold War, Deaths of civilians and military. Consequences The Korean War was a conflict that lasted three years and brought with it numerous deaths in battle, as well as a lack of food and inadequate living conditions. Death figures are estimated at a total of approximately 2 million. In North Korea, an estimated 1,187,000 to 1,545,000 died, of which 736,000 were military deaths. As for South Korea, it is estimated that 778,000 people died, of which at least 373,500 were civilians.

What did the Pacific Railway Act of 1862 do?
hjlf

This act provided Federal government support for the building of the first transcontinental railroad, which was completed on May 10.

3. What effect would this policy have on the Native American population in the western territories?
Igoryamba

Answer:

As settlers moved West, Native American tribes were made to move from their lands to make way for homesteads and the railroad. Buffalo migration was also affected by the settlers. Settlers often killed buffalo for sport. This created food shortages for the Native Americans.
